Output e6e40415134c8cb8196de63d6109fe1b921260977d467ef6da3bb65314b42a82:56

value
58831
script pubkey
OP_0 OP_PUSHBYTES_20 dd181b8626c6ee7d88768051282a46ea46627c8e
address
bc1qm5vphp3xcmh8mzrkspgjs2jxafrxylywmeudns
transaction
e6e40415134c8cb8196de63d6109fe1b921260977d467ef6da3bb65314b42a82
spent
true